Currently, I'm missing my soul and all the magic that comes with it. For extra athame-in-
the-eye fun, I'm being held prisoner by Shifter Nation. Whoa Goddess, do they have plans
for me. Plans no sane witch would ever agree to be a part of.
I never wanted to start a war.
I just wanted to live a quiet, witchy life.
But my soul has its own destiny, and if I don't get it back, I'll have no say in what
happens next.
Hold on to your wands, beyotches, because this witch never says die.

USA Today and NY Times bestselling author Michelle Fox lives in the Midwest with her husband, teen, the occasional exchange student, and two labs who steal her socks and all the space on the couch. She loves fantasy and romance, which makes writing paranormal romance and urban fantasy a natural fit. Aside from writing, she runs the Wolf Pack Reads group on Facebook, a large, active community for readers (you should join!). In her spare time, she helps remodel her 1860 farmhouse and tries not to murder the garden. Her primary function, however, is to serve as the wheels and wallet for her teen. She loves chocolate, drinks a lot of tea, and still believes in magic.
